Maintain overall business control for Flight operations and Network operation systems, including Crewing, Planning and Operations Systems, in terms of user access management, security audits compliance, change requests, release management and administration requirements for all users.
Accountabilities
- Maintain the user access management process and review user access on a regular basis to ensure internal process meet regulatory requirements.
- Monitor system performance and provide support to reduce operational costs and increase efficiency.
- Implement new system features and maintain control over changes applied across all supported systems to ensure that the systems interface with each other seamlessly.
- Resolve any problems that arise during normal function of the system and provide status updates to end users and stakeholders. Fully assess the severity of all problems reported to ensure that the vendor is engaged as necessary.
- Liaise with the vendor on issue resolution and the implementation of system enhancements to maintain control on issues raised with the vendor and ensure delivery within agreed SLAs.
- Collaborate with EY T&I to implement upgrades as per agreed timelines to ensure that systems environment and their components are configured and working correctly.
- Working closely with the Crew Planners, Crew Services and Ops teams to refine system set-up to adapt Rostering, Pairing, Crewing and ops system to business changes.
- Post-secondary education (ie. Diploma, degree and/or courses in related field or equivalent work experience).
- Minimum 3 years’ experience on systems within Airline operations/ Technical Support (either in airlines and / or as a vendor).
